EUX AUTRES

Broken Arrow

2011-07-09

On the third album from San Francisco band, Eux Autres, you get alternating boy/girl vocals (brother/sister Nicholas/Heather Larimer) over jangly 60’s-style guitars. You also get lots of “oohs” and “la-la-las” combined with decidedly contemporary production. This adds up to modern day indie pop that weirdly can sometimes be both upbeat and melancholy simultaneously. I liked this one, but I have to recommend (even more) checking out the website for the claymation/puppet videos (made by band member, Nicholas Larimer) as well. Rebecca Ruth
